Scope and content
Fonds consists of an autograph book of political, military and religious leaders of contemporary Canada containing autographs, original letters, photographs and, in some cases, short biographical sketches, 1861-1868; and a letter of introduction for Charles S. Ogden as United States Consul at Quebec in 1861. The original scrapbook was dismantled in 1987 and withdrawn from circulation.

Terms of use
The original scrapbook is out of circulation; photocopies are available for research purposes.
Finding aid
Textual records: Names of the individuals have been incorporated into the General Index, a paper based card index. (Paper)

Biography / Administrative history
Charles S. Ogden was United States Consul at Quebec in 1861.
